WebSep 14, 2024 · High on the western coast of Alaska on the Bering Sea, Nome is a frontier town built on gold and the fur trade. Founded in 1901, it’s closer to Siberia than the state’s biggest city, Anchorage. And this remote position would present a nightmare scenario when in 1925, a disease began to grip the town’s children. WebMay 28, 2024 · The purchase of Alaska was done by William Seward in 1867 and approved by congress quickly. This was done as a way of keeping the British away. Alaska was purchased for $7.2 million from Russia. Why was Alaska called Seward folly? It was called Seward's Folly because the United States Secretary of State, William Seward,
